    Position Overview

    The Registered Practical Nurse applies public health knowledge, techniques, and skills to promote health and wellness and prevent disease in accordance with the Ontario Public Health Standards and associated Protocols and Guidelines; and the Health Protection and Promotion Act and associated Regulations.

    The Registered Practical Nurse promotes public health through such activities as assisting Public Health Nurses and Registered Nurses in the provision of mandated public health programs and clinical related services. Meeting the provision of service within Sexual Health, Vaccine Preventable Disease, Tuberculosis, and Sexually Transmitted Infection program areas.

    Duties and Responsibilities

    Duties:

    •Schedule appointments

    •Provide telephone nursing services

    •Maintain clinical files, documentation and statistics

    •Conduct pregnancy tests

    •Draw blood for lab tests

    •Dispense prescriptions and other contraceptives

    •Maintain vaccines and supplies for clinics

    •Administer and record immunizations given in clinics

    •Maintain vaccine usage database

    •Conduct TB skin tests

    •Use teaching to explain concepts of public health practice, including possible consequences and resolutions using both written and oral communication skills

    •Collaborate with other health care providers

    •Assist in the training and orientation of students and other personnel as assigned

    •Participate in ongoing professional development opportunities and maintain current professional knowledge of practices, trends, regulations, techniques, procedures, equipment, sampling and documentation

    •Responsible for professional competence as a Registered Practical Nurse in accordance with applicable legislation and County policy

    Qualifications

    Minimum Formal Education:

    •Grade 12 plus post-secondary diploma in Practical Nursing (Two Years)

    •Ontario Practical Nurse Registration Examination of the College of Nurses of Ontario

    Experience:

    •6 months to 1 year
